用不同排序方法对数据序列(8,7,4,1,5,9,2,6,3)进行递增排序,写出每种排序方法第一趟和第二趟排序完后的元素序列。快速排序,堆排序,二路归并排序
时间: 2024-05-18 13:14:14 浏览: 88
数据结构上机题1-5章参考答案
好的,我来回答你的问题。
下面是对数据序列(8,7,4,1,5,9,2,6,3)进行递增排序的三种排序方法及其第一趟和第二趟排序的结果:
1. 快速排序:
第一趟排序后的序列为:3,1,4,2,5,9,8,6,7
第二趟排序后的序列为:1,2,3,4,5,9,8,6,7
2. 堆排序:
第一趟排序后的序列为:9,7,4,6,5,1,2,8,3
第二趟排序后的序列为:8,7,4,6,5,1,2,3,9
3. 二路归并排序:
第一趟排序后的序列为:7,8,1,4,5,9,2,3,6
第二趟排序后的序列为:1,4,7,8,2,5,9,3,6
希望这样的回答能够解决你的问题。
阅读全文